Abstract

The analysis of a kernel involving the product of three Bessel functions motivates the introduction of the translation operator and the convolution associated to the Hankel–Kontorovich–Lebedev tranformation, first in a classical framework, and then in certain spaces of generalized functions. The main properties of this convolution are investigated, the more important operational rules are obtained and some applications are shown. (© 2008 WILEY‐VCH Verlag GmbH & Co. KGaA, Weinheim)
